      The Spansion Expansion
      i think there are a number of upsides, which makes bankruptcy unlikely, in my opinion.
      1) they have been taking share from Numonyx et al. and will continue to take share from any 200mm producer. with only have 1/3 of the market right now, what's to stop them being the Samsung of NOR?
      2) they have a data product that they at least believe can compete with a low density nand.
      3) they have the eclipse product, which looks to me like a very cool thing. it gives the oem's the chance to build mutiple products around the same "engine," if you will, by just changing the software. that led to savings at all the automakers, and it strikes me as a great value-add for phones too.
      4) SMIC is finally making progress on a NAND device using Spansion's/Saifun's IP.
      5) DRAM market is a potential target if Spansion manges to shrink to 45nm by '09.
      Of course there is always the risk nothing works. But with so much potential it looks less like a Ford and more like Boeing before the announced the Dreamliner.
